Output 61faf7a42bde2d9d3da12749ee76134636c063fc57485d9b7eb59b9bbc3657dc:7

value
153099982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 658a8333bf76a07dc9e091ef68b1f97d0b9b079b OP_EQUAL
address
3Awv6wGPtRK4BY3C8WNNJrAN7VA2zCYrVd
transaction
61faf7a42bde2d9d3da12749ee76134636c063fc57485d9b7eb59b9bbc3657dc
spent
true